         <description><![CDATA[<div>Lethal alleles may be completely dominant, incompletely dominant, or recessive.&nbsp;<br><br>Manx cats!!!!<br>The manx allele is incompletely dominant. Heterozygous offspring show some spinal development with a tail which is a blend of full tail cats and abnormal spine development seen in homozygous individuals.</div>]]></description>

         <title>Crossing Over</title>
         <author>floreenaroberts04</author>
         <link>https://padlet.com/kcbioteacher/rxl00jj2f2fq/wish/114005670</link>
         <description><![CDATA[<div>Crossing over is a form of variation and occurs in a stage of meiosis. One chromatid of each chromosome homologous pair is swapped with each other. This is a form of variation as it creates different combinations of dominant and recessive alleles.</div><div><br></div>]]></description>
